My system is very basic and works very well. It starts with a leather bag which I designed, and had made, with one separator creating two compartments, an internal pocket and two outside pockets, one in the front for my wallet and one in the back with a zipper for keys and other stuff. The second aspect of my system is a blank book without lines. I live by this system.
In the bag I have a place for my wallet, calculator, business cards, cell phone and whatever ‘stuff” I need for the day. I carry chargers, chords, books, pens, etc. and whatever other items I may need.
This works for a few reasons. I have a place for all my stuff, and this is critical….everything I need is always available. I don’t ever forget something I need and everything I need has a place to be returned too so I do not lose important items. It has a shoulder strap which is also critical as it leaves both hands available.
The second important item in my system is my blank book…addresses, appointments, cash flows, to do lists, phone numbers, whatever I need I write in my book and have it forever. I go through a book in 3-6 months and occasionally refer back to them as most valuable resources.
My life is organized around these two items, my book and my bag. Of course my book has a special location in the bag.
